Dance Classes


The Studio offers dance classes in ballet, jazz, tap, contemporary, and lyrical.

Q: I'm familiar with the first few, but what are lyrical and contemporary?

A: A beautiful blend of ballet, modern, and jazz techniques, lyrical is commonly set to contemporary music with vocals or just instrumental bars. One goal of lyrical dance is to use gesture, expression, and controlled movements in order to execute movements and portray emotions. Besides emotional connection to music, lyrical dance typically encourages use of articulation, line, weight, and other movement qualities.

Contemporary dance draws on modern and postmodern dance, classical ballet, and other dance techniques. It can express a free type of movement and the choreography is more diverse than other specific genres. Levels

Open-level Classes: All levels welcome

All classes are open level unless otherwise specified. Open-level classes pay particular attention to the variety of ability levels of dancers present in that particular class. Modifications are suggested to make movements and combinations either easier or more challenging for each student. Instructors demonstrate and explain terminology when needed, focusing on students’ alignment and comprehension throughout class.


Beginner Classes

Taught at a relaxed pace with a focus on learning or re-learning the basics, beginner classes prepare students for all other Studio classes. Ideal for students new to dance or that dance style, or for students returning to dance after an extended absence, our beginner classes provide students with a firm foundation in proper alignment, technique, and basic vocabulary.


Elementary Classes

Students in elementary classes typically have a basic familiarity with all standard vocabulary and  exercises, either from other Studio classes, or from prior dance experience. Movement sequences and combinations vary from class to class. Center exercises include elements from the warm-up, as well as stationary and locomotor movements, balances, turns, and small and large jumps. A short piece of choreography that incorporates elements from the warm-up and center work may conclude the class.


Intermediate Classes

Students are expected to be familiar with standard warm-up exercises, coordination exercises, turns, jumps, and various balances. Center exercises and choreography combine stationary and locomotor movements, balances, turns, small and large jumps, with a focus on building strength, agility, and coordination.
